Sweden: NPB's Accounts Have Been Blocked, over 30 Million Euros in Compensation to Investors

Summary by Telegrafi
The leader of the Vetëvendosje Movement assembly members' group in Pristina, Gëzim Sveçla, has raised new accusations regarding the situation of the Public Housing Enterprise (NPB), claiming that the enterprise's bank accounts have been blocked following a decision by the Commercial Court.
